引言
随着科技的不断发展,电脑棋手已经成为棋类游戏中的强大对手。从国际象棋到围棋,电脑棋手在算法和数据处理方面的优势使得它们能够在棋盘上与人类高手一较高下。本文将深入探讨电脑棋手对决的可能性,以及它们如何帮助提升你的棋力。
电脑棋手的起源与发展
电脑棋手的起源
电脑棋手的历史可以追溯到20世纪50年代。当时,科学家们开始探索如何利用计算机算法来模拟棋类游戏。1951年,IBM公司推出了世界上第一个电脑棋手——“逻辑理论家”,它能够在简单的棋盘游戏中与人类对弈。
电脑棋手的发展
随着时间的推移,电脑棋手的算法和数据处理能力得到了极大的提升。尤其是近年来,随着深度学习技术的发展,电脑棋手在围棋、国际象棋等复杂棋类游戏中的表现已经超越了人类顶尖高手。
电脑棋手的对决优势
算法优势
电脑棋手使用的算法主要包括最小化极大化(Minimax)搜索、Alpha-Beta剪枝、蒙特卡洛树搜索等。这些算法能够在短时间内评估棋局的复杂程度,并找到最佳走法。
数据处理优势
电脑棋手能够快速处理大量的棋局数据,分析棋手们的走法,从而提高自己的棋力。此外,电脑棋手还能够通过自我对弈来不断优化自己的算法。
持续学习
电脑棋手能够通过不断学习来提升自己的棋力。例如,AlphaGo通过学习大量的棋局数据,逐渐提高了自己的棋艺。
电脑棋手对决对棋力的提升作用
提高自我认知
与电脑棋手对弈可以帮助棋手更好地了解自己的棋力,发现自己的不足之处,从而有针对性地进行训练。
学习新的走法
电脑棋手往往能够找到一些出人意料的走法,这可以帮助棋手开阔视野,学习新的棋局思路。
提高应变能力
与电脑棋手对弈需要棋手具备快速应变的能力。这种能力在现实生活中的其他领域也非常重要。
如何利用电脑棋手提升棋力
选择合适的电脑棋手
目前,市面上有许多优秀的电脑棋手软件,如Stockfish、Fritz等。棋手可以根据自己的需求和喜好选择合适的电脑棋手。
制定合理的训练计划
与电脑棋手对弈时,棋手应该制定合理的训练计划,确保自己在对弈过程中能够有所收获。
总结经验教训
每场对弈结束后,棋手应该总结经验教训,分析自己在棋局中的得失,从而不断提高自己的棋力。
结论
电脑棋手对决已经成为棋类游戏的重要组成部分。通过与电脑棋手对弈,棋手可以提升自己的棋力,学习新的走法,提高应变能力。因此,电脑棋手对决对于棋手来说是一个不可多得的机会。
